AugBalWeight: Augmented Balancing Weights as Linear Regression

R-CMD-check License: GPL v3

AugBalWeight implements the methodology from the Journal of the Royal Statistical Society Series B paper: > Bruns-Smith, D., Dukes, O., Feller, A., & Ogburn, E. L. (2026). Augmented balancing weights as linear regression. Journal of the Royal Statistical Society Series B: Statistical Methodology, 88(3), 699–723. https://doi.org/10.1093/jrsssb/qkaf019.

Quick Example

library(AugBalWeight)

# Load canonical LaLonde dataset
data(lalonde_data)

# Estimate ATT (Average Treatment Effect on the Treated)
fit_att <- aug_bal_att(
  Y = lalonde_data$re78,
  Z = lalonde_data$treat,
  X = lalonde_data[, c("age", "educ", "black", "hisp", "married", "re74", "re75")],
  type = "l2"
)

summary(fit_att)
plot(fit_att)
